Anatomy-Skeletal System Joint Structure- Hinge n n n Convex surface of one bone fits into the concave depression of another bone ROM occurs in one plane n Flexion-Extension Elbow, Knee & Interphalangeal Joints

Anatomy-Skeletal System Joint Structure- Pivot n n n Cylindrical or rounded surface of one bone fits into the ring of another bone or ligament ROM occurs in rotation only Radioulnar & Atlas/Axis

Anatomy-Skeletal System Joint Structure- Gliding n n n Articular surfaces are flat or nearly flat ROM occurs as gliding (sliding) or twisting Carpals & Tarsals
